Atoms or ions as well as color centers in crystals offer suitable two-level systems for absorbing incoming photons. To obtain a reliable transfer of coherence, strong enough light-matter interaction is required, which may enforce use of ensembles of absorbers, but has the disadvantage of unavoidable inhomogeneities leading to fast dephasing. This obstacle can be overcome by echo techniques that allow recovery of the information as long as the coherence is preserved.
